The Equal Probability of Every Combination

One of the most fundamental aspects of playing the EuroMillions is understanding that each possible combination of numbers has the same probability of being drawn. The EuroMillions draw is a game of pure chance, with a mathematical foundation that makes it impossible to predict which numbers will come up.

  1. Why Randomness Matters
    In each EuroMillions draw, five numbers are drawn from a pool of 1 to 50, along with two “Star” numbers from a separate pool of 1 to 12. This creates a total of 139,838,160 possible combinations. The selection of these numbers is completely random, meaning that each combination, whether it includes dates like “3, 14, 22, 28, 36” or a seemingly bizarre sequence like “1, 2, 3, 4, 5, Stars 6 and 7,” has exactly the same odds of being drawn.
  2. Avoiding the Common Pitfall of Overused Numbers
    Many people who choose their own numbers tend to rely on dates and other familiar sequences, which often restricts their choices to numbers between 1 and 31. This is because many players use birthdays or anniversaries, which are tied to days of the month. As a result, numbers beyond 31 are less frequently chosen, creating a scenario where if a combination including higher numbers wins, the prize is less likely to be shared among multiple winners. Using a random number generator allows players to spread their selections across the full range, potentially reducing the likelihood of having to split a jackpot with others.

The Psychology of “Lucky” Numbers

Despite the mathematical reality of equal probability, many players are drawn to the idea of using “lucky” numbers—those that have personal meaning or that they believe hold a special power. This tendency is rooted in deeper psychological factors that influence human behavior.

  1. The Emotional Connection to Numbers
    For many players, the choice of numbers is deeply personal. Using dates like birthdays or anniversaries infuses each ticket with a sense of significance and emotional weight. The idea of winning with numbers that are tied to a special moment in one’s life can be appealing and meaningful. This emotional connection can make the act of playing feel more engaging, even though it does not alter the odds of winning.
  2. The Illusion of Control
    Another psychological aspect that draws people to use their own number selections is the illusion of control. In an inherently unpredictable game, choosing numbers can give players a false sense of influence over the outcome. This is a natural human tendency—people want to feel that their actions can have an impact, even in situations that are entirely governed by chance. The random number generator removes this sense of control, which can feel unsettling to some players but ultimately aligns with the true nature of the lottery.
  3. Superstition and Patterns
    Superstition also plays a significant role in how people select their numbers. Some players believe that certain numbers are inherently luckier than others or that avoiding specific “unlucky” numbers can improve their chances. Patterns like choosing all odd numbers or selecting a balanced mix of odd and even numbers are common strategies among those who select their own numbers. However, these patterns are purely subjective and do not affect the true randomness of each draw.

Random Numbers as a Strategic Choice

Given the psychology behind number selection and the inherent randomness of EuroMillions draws, opting for a random number generator can be seen as a strategic choice for players who wish to optimize their chances of a unique win.

  1. Random Selection and the Law of Large Numbers
    The Law of Large Numbers is a principle of probability that states that as the number of trials increases, the outcomes will reflect the expected probabilities more closely. In the context of EuroMillions, this means that over time, randomly chosen numbers are just as likely to win as any other strategy. While the lottery is a game where each draw is independent, random selection allows players to trust in the fairness of the game without getting bogged down by subjective preferences.
  2. The Quick Pick Advantage
    Many players who opt for random numbers use the “quick pick” feature offered by lottery retailers and online platforms. This method automatically generates a set of random numbers, making the process fast and easy. The quick pick option has become increasingly popular among occasional players who might only participate when the jackpot reaches a certain threshold. By taking human bias out of the equation, quick picks can ensure that numbers are chosen without any influence from personal preferences or superstitions.
  3. Lower Chances of Sharing a Prize
    Another advantage of choosing random numbers is the reduced likelihood of having to share a prize. When players select numbers based on common dates or sequences, they are more likely to end up with a combination that other players have also chosen. If a popular combination wins, the prize can be split among many winners, significantly reducing the payout for each individual. Random numbers, especially those that include a spread across the entire number range, reduce the chances of this scenario, making it more likely that a winner will take home the full prize.
